Section 920.210 - Examination for Closed Loop Well Contractor Certification and Fees

c) A person holding a valid water well contractor's license issued under the Water Well and Pump Installation Contractor's License Act may apply to the Department and shall receive, without examination or fee, closed loop well contractor certification if, as part of the application, the person submits a copy of his or her current Water Well Contractor's License and provided that all other requirements of the Illinois Water Well Construction Code are met.
d) Any person who installs horizontal closed loop wells using only the open trench method shall be exempt from certification under this Section.
e) Certification shall expire if the person holding the certifications fails to register within two years after becoming certified, or a person registered in accordance with Section 920.220 allows his or her registration to lapse for more than three years.
